%javamethodmodifiers RDGeom::Transform3D::Transform3D ( ) "
|
|
/**
|
|
<p>
|
|
Constructor.
|
|
<p>
|
|
Initialize to an identity matrix transformation. This is a 4x4 matrix that includes the rotation and translation parts see Foley's 'Introduction to Computer Graphics' for the representation
|
|
<p>
|
|
Operator *= and = are provided by the parent class square matrix. Operator *= needs some explanation, since the order matters. This transform gets set to the combination other and the current state of this transform If this_old and this_new are the states of this object before and after this function we have this_new(point) = this_old(other(point))
|
|
|
|
*/
|
|
public";
